Elap WDS absolute multiturn pull-wire encoder with fieldbus communications

Wednesday, 04 July, 2012 | Supplied by: Motion Technologies Pty Ltd


Motion Technologies is now supplying the Elap WDS absolute multiturn pull-wire encoder, featuring industrial standard Profibus, CANopen or SSI outputs.

Measurement strokes from 3000 to 15,000 mm are available as standard, with resolution ranging from 0.6 to 1.5 mm. Special lengths of 30 to 50 m are available on request.

The WDS cable mechanism, constructed with an aluminium case with coated polyamid stainless steel pull wire, is built to suit harsh environments and the temperature range -20 to +80°C.

Coupled with the MEM520 multiturn absolute encoder with up to 29-bit resolution, industry-standard fieldbus protocols are now available for long-length measurement applications requiring absolute position feedback.

Application suits industrial environments where absolute linear measurement is required, and the encoder output must integrate with an existing control system via Profibus, CANopen or SSI.
